ZC121-LD6251BR - Living District: Lyle 1 light Brass and frosted white glass Flush mountThe Lyle Collection is a stunningly functional, yet simplistically lovely light. The geometric shade creates a clean form that will fit well in any space, large or small. Its versatile simplicity allows for this fixture to blend in well with the rest of your room, while still maintaining its own bright personality. Available in a black, chrome, or brass finish, and a clear bubble or frosted white shade, let this ceiling lamp illuminate your room

Specifications:
  • Room uses: Living Room; Dining Room; Ktichen; Bar
  • Finish/color: Brass & Frosted White Glass
  • Fixture material: Metal & Glass
  • Crystal color: N/A
  • Shade color: Frosted White
  • Size/weight: 8L x 8W x 11H / 2.4 Lbs
  • Number of lights: 1
  • Light bulb info: E26 40w - Dimmable
  • Light bulbs included: No
  • UL standard: UL & ULC
  • Assembly required: No
  • Product warranty: 1 Year
